Vyhledávání na webu

Jak přidat nebo odebrat uživatele ze skupiny v Linuxu


Linux je ve výchozím nastavení víceuživatelský systém (to znamená, že se k němu může připojit a pracovat mnoho uživatelů současně), takže správa uživatelů Linuxu je jedním ze základních úkolů správce systému, který zahrnuje vše od vytváření, aktualizace a mazání uživatelských účtů nebo skupiny uživatelů v systému Linux.

V tomto krátkém rychlém článku se dozvíte, jak přidat nebo odebrat uživatele ze skupiny v systému Linux.

Zkontrolujte skupinu uživatelů v systému Linux

Chcete-li zjistit, ve které skupině se uživatel nachází, stačí spustit následující příkaz groups a zadat username (v tomto příkladu tecmint) jako argument .

groups tecmint

tecmint : tecmint wheel

Chcete-li zjistit skupinu uživatelů root v Linuxu, stačí spustit příkaz groups bez jakéhokoli argumentu.

group

root

Přidejte uživatele do skupiny v Linuxu

Než se pokusíte přidat uživatele do skupiny, ujistěte se, že uživatel v systému existuje. Chcete-li přidat uživatele do určité skupiny, použijte příkaz usermod s příznakem -a, který říká usermod, aby přidal uživatele do doplňkových skupin, a Volba -G určuje skutečné skupiny v následujícím formátu.

V tomto příkladu je tecmint uživatelské jméno a postgres je název skupiny:

usermod -aG postgres tecmint
groups tecmint

Odebrat uživatele ze skupiny v Linuxu

Chcete-li odebrat uživatele ze skupiny, použijte příkaz gpasswd s volbou -d následovně.

gpasswd -d tecmint postgres
groups tecmint

Navíc na Ubuntu a jeho derivátech můžete odebrat uživatele z konkrétní skupiny pomocí příkazu deluser následovně (kde tecmint je uživatelské jméno a postgres je název skupiny).

sudo deluser tecmint postgres

Další informace naleznete v manuálových stránkách pro každý z různých příkazů, které jsme v tomto článku použili.

man groups
man usermod
man gpasswd
man deluser

Velmi užitečné budou také následující příručky pro správu uživatelů: